WordPress интернет-магазин: создание с нуля (Урок 1)

Этот урок посвящен созданию интернет-магазина на базе WordPress. Рассмотрим создание дизайна и добавление необходимых функций. Сначала познакомимся с платформой WordPress.

Что такое WordPress и почему он популярен?

WordPress, появившийся в 2003 году, постоянно развивается и остаётся удобной технологией для создания сайтов различной тематики. Написанный на PHP с использованием MySQL для управления базами данных, он позволяет создавать сайты – от простых одностраничников до крупных интернет-магазинов с корзиной товаров и дополнительными услугами.

Популярность WordPress обусловлена простотой использования. Это мощный конструктор, позволяющий создавать сайты без написания кода благодаря удобному графическому редактору с перетаскиванием блоков. Обширная библиотека плагинов расширяет функциональность, добавляя системы оплаты, комментарии, формы регистрации и многое другое. Хотя некоторые плагины платные, их стоимость обычно невелика по сравнению с заказом разработки у агентства.

WordPress — эффективный инструмент для быстрого создания сайтов с необходимым функционалом. Хотя он сложнее некоторых конструкторов, это обусловлено большим объёмом функциональности. На WordPress работают многие популярные сайты, включая Crunchbase, Sony Music, PlayStation, Block Nine tomack и другие. Статистика показывает, что примерно 43% всех сайтов в мире созданы на WordPress, а количество пользователей увеличивается на 12% в год с 2011 года. 65% сайтов, созданных на основе CMS, используют WordPress, что подтверждает его актуальность и востребованность.

Установка WordPress

Для установки WordPress скачайте последнюю версию с официального сайта (ссылка опущена). Потребуется сервер – локальный или удалённый. В этом курсе используется локальный сервер, а для размещения сайта в интернете — хостинг.

Для локального сервера можно использовать MAMP (ссылка опущена), Open Server или XAMPP. Они работают схожим образом. После запуска выбранной программы откройте стартовую страницу (например, указав адрес localhost:8888 (для MAMP) в браузере). Ссылка на ваш сайт обычно находится на этой странице, или можно указать localhost:80 или localhost.

Распакуйте скачанный архив WordPress и скопируйте файлы в папку htdocs (путь к папке может отличаться в зависимости от используемой программы, например, Applications/MAMP/htdocs). Обновите страницу браузера, и вы увидите процесс установки WordPress.

Процесс установки и настройка

  1. Выбор языка: Выберите русский язык и нажмите «Продолжить».
  2. Первая конфигурация: Прочтите информацию и нажмите «Вперед».
  3. Настройка базы данных: Создайте базу данных в phpMyAdmin (доступна по адресу localhost/phpmyadmin). Укажите имя базы данных (например, wordpress), кодировку utf8mb4_general_ci и создайте её.
  4. Подключение к базе данных: Укажите имя пользователя и пароль для доступа к базе данных (для MAMP обычно root и пустой пароль). Укажите localhost в качестве сервера. Префикс таблиц можно оставить пустым или указать свой. Нажмите «Отправить».
  5. Запуск установки: Нажмите «Запустить установку».
  6. Настройка сайта: Укажите название сайта (например, itproger), создайте учётную запись администратора с логином и паролем, укажите email и отметьте опцию о запрете индексации сайта поисковыми системами. Нажмите «Установить WordPress».
  7. Вход в админ-панель: После завершения установки войдите в админ-панель, используя указанные логин и пароль.

Теперь у вас установлен WordPress. На следующем уроке начнём разработку интернет-магазина. На текущем этапе у нас есть готовый сайт на базе WordPress. Весь курс доступен на сайте it-proger.com (ссылка опущена).

Что будем искать? Например,программа